I've built 2 dac boards, both of which work, so I'll add my suggestions. First, if one is building a single ended DAC (not balanced) then the parts U7, R10, C30, and JP1 are not needed. I'm not sure why tome had better results shorting JP1.

Tome's comments did make me think that perhaps Skoulike had forgotten about the parts on the other side of the board. Parts R14, R15, and C12 are on the back of the board. In particular, if you don't add R14 and R15 (zero ohm jumpers) then the outputs won't be connected. Please check this.
